Famous landmarks in Madaba

Madaba, known for its rich mosaic heritage and historical significance, is home to several remarkable landmarks that attract travelers from around the globe. One of the most notable sites is the St. George’s Church, famous for its 6th-century mosaic map of the Holy Land, located in the heart of the city. The Madaba Archaeological Park showcases ancient ruins and artifacts, offering insight into the city's long history. Just a short drive away is Mount Nebo, a significant religious site where, according to tradition, Moses is said to have viewed the Promised Land. The Madaba Mosaic Map Museum presents a collection of exquisite mosaics that emphasize the craftsmanship of ancient artisans. For a more contemporary experience, visitors can explore the modern art installations at the Madaba Contemporary Art Museum. Must-see landmarks in Madaba

The landmarks of Madaba serve as a seamless connection to the past, shaping the city's identity and illustrating its historical significance. Each site tells a story that enhances the overall experience of this fascinating destination.

  • St. George’s Church: Home to the famous Madaba Mosaic Map, this church is a pilgrimage site that attracts visitors from around the world.
  • Madaba Archaeological Park: A rich area containing the ruins of ancient churches and mosaics that highlight the city’s historical importance.
  • Mount Nebo: A short drive from Madaba offers stunning views and biblical significance, as it is believed to be the burial site of Moses.
  • Church of the Virgin Mary: This location features exquisite mosaics and is a significant site for both history and religious heritage.
  • Madaba Museum: This museum showcases the region’s artistic history and artifacts, making it a vital stop for understanding Madaba’s heritage.
  • Al-Khader Church: Known for its striking mosaics, this church is yet another representation of the city’s deep ecclesiastical traditions.
  • The Fountain of the Seven Saints: A beautiful spot that serves as a peaceful retreat and holds cultural significance.

Visitor information and tickets

Planning your visit to Madaba can be seamless with the right information about key attractions. Knowing opening hours and ticket prices can enhance your sightseeing experience.

  • Opening Hours: Most attractions are open from 8 AM to 5 PM, though some may extend hours during peak tourist seasons.
  • Ticket Prices: Entry to major sites like St. George's Church is usually around 2 JOD, while museums may charge more, (average 3-5 JOD).
  • Free Attractions: Enjoy the beautiful parks and some outdoor historical sites at no cost.
  • Guided Tours: Booking guided tours in advance is recommended, especially during peak periods, to ensure a well-rounded experience.
